Is Trump or Biden Better for Post-Brexit Britain? Henry Ridgwell LONDON - In 2016, many analysts saw parallels between the election of Donald Trump as U.S. president and Britain's vote to leave the European Union, casting both as victories for populist politics. Four years on, Trump is up for re-election while Britain will leave the Brexit transition period at the end of the year. Those analysts now say Britain's post-Brexit future could be closely tied with the outcome of the November 3 U.S. presidential election. The British government is looking to the United States for a new trade deal to boost its economy. However, any hopes that such a deal would be quick and easy have faded rapidly, says Ian Bond of the Center for European Reform, in a recent interview. .
